gpt4 book ai didi

exception - Microsoft Jet 数据库引擎找不到对象

转载 作者:行者123 更新时间:2023-12-02 23:05:18 26 4
gpt4 key购买 nike

我正在从文件位置读取 shapefile,读取其元数据并将其写入 SSIS 包中的数据库中。

SSIS 包在我的本地计算机上成功运行。我在服务器上部署了相同的 SQL 作业,当我在服务器上运行该作业(在 SSIS 执行器代理下运行)时,它会抛出 OLEDB 异常:

The Microsoft Jet database engine could not find the object 'tmp5330'. Make sure the object exists and that you spell its name and the path name correctly.

它肯定发生在脚本组件上,我从文件位置读取 shapefile 并处理元数据。我已仔细检查 SSIS 帐户是否具有文件位置(文件所在的最后一个文件夹)的权限,并且它肯定具有读取权限。

如果有人能提供帮助,那就太好了。

最佳答案

问题出在 Jet Engine 的配置中,看起来它不接受长度超过八个字符的文件:

修复此问题:“重命名该文件,使其与 MS-DOS 8.3 文件名格式匹配。也就是说,文件名的长度不得超过八个字符,并且句点后必须有正确的扩展名,例如 dBASE 文件的 .dbf。'

参见http://support.microsoft.com/kb/209685了解更多详情。

关于exception - Microsoft Jet 数据库引擎找不到对象,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12134502/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com